Output ab644ccaf3c7520554ff3c31421f6c56711a7f66fa6a31e5e5fdf88fc6b43d17:51

value
189525
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bd196ceda156d97e803d3c0e550ae58495c15935 OP_EQUALVERIFY OP_CHECKSIG
address
1JEsArLqops7wuVzmNEasGH7AvBiJ77BhR
transaction
ab644ccaf3c7520554ff3c31421f6c56711a7f66fa6a31e5e5fdf88fc6b43d17
confirmations
354091
spent
true